Quivers share "If Only" and announce U.S. tour dates [Video]

Melbourne, Australia based Quivers return with a tale of yearning in their new single "If Only". The track follows their critically acclaimed 2021 album Golden Doubt.

"If Only" is an Americana-dipped, slow-burned pop-rock single all about wanting someone at the wrong time. The track is the first time member Bella Quinlan takes the lead on the vocals. With lyrics including, "If only I could make you love me / Before you move overseas / What a fucked up thing to want / Love should just be / It’s there or it’s not / Let romance rot / Don’t let it get into your lungs," Bella understands her deep longing for a love that can't happen and how disruptive and damaging that can be. "If Only" entices with honey-dipped vocals, steady grunge guitar riffs and heightened melodies that drip with nostalgia and passion. Dreamy and pensive indie rock landscapes highlight the song's introspective narrative of lust gone wrong.

In the accompanying visuals filmed and edited by Nina Renee, the band pays homage to the Final Girl trope, and car tropes in horror films with a romantic twist. Bella is seen in an old car at night singing when a ghost who is a past lover visits her and kisses her passionately. The video is a haunting queer romance that is a perfect accompaniment to the single.

Formed in Tasmania Australia and first sharing music in 2017, Quivers is known for their charming indie pop thrilling audiences around the globe. Alongside the release of "If Only", the band shared a stunning cover of "I Wanted to See You So Bad" by Lucinda Williams and announced a U.S. tour.
